Originally Posted by David3627
Up to 2 weeks for the CAL process/decision. Up to 6 weeks for the work permit process/decision.

Once issued, the CAL is valid for 14 days from the detail on the CAL.

Source: Application Guide for Foreign Applicants – International Experience Canada (IEC)

Also: they said IF APPLICABLE. So if you don't have a ticket and still in your home country: DON'T SWEAT IT.
Of course, there is conflicting information on CIC website. Here under work permit eligibility it says CAL is valid for 7 days:

International Mobility Program: Canadian interests – Reciprocal employment – International Experience Canada [R205(b)] (exemption code C21)
